Here is a run down of the car
It's done 83k Miles which for a 2003 is low; it's got a clean bill of health on the MOT which is next due in October.
Usual ZT+ spec, has electric rear windows and dual zone climate, heated and electric mirrors
It also has the Alcantara seats which are in very good condition, no major wear and NO RIPS!
No water leaks in the boot the light seals have been replaced recently!

It also has a Tony Banks / Long-life Stainless exhaust which makes the V6 sound as it should! It's not too loud especially when cruising at 70 it's barely audible (receipt for £401)
It has a Pipercross panel filter also which I cleaned and re-oiled last week.

It's got tons of history so I'll list the major important stuff
Mechanically it really is perfect.
• Full cam belt kit done 3 months ago
• New Recon Cylinder heads (done at same time as belts/head)
• Aux belt and new alternator
• New Thermostat (done at same time as belts/head)
• Rattle Free Inlet manifold
• VIS motors repaired
• New power Steering pump & Fluid
• New discs on the front and pads all round ( fitted and done when belts/heads were done)

• Brake fluid completely flushed and changed
• Plugs and full service done with heads/belts
• Wiring loom to coil packs replaced
• Tyres are good all round 5mm+
• Battery replaced in 2014
• Compensator mod - This basically fixes the handbrake issues
• New Windscreen (RAC) and wipers (Aero style)

#Also have a spare set of 6 spark plugs that i will give with the car these were bought in advance as a service kit which was not needed, oil & filter was changed about 5 days ago using Mobil1 oil - it wasnt due but i like to keep on top of things.

Now there are obviously a few bad bits although not a lot!
The main one is the bodywork, although it's straight and tidy it does have some scratches and a light creases/dents in the bonnet, there's also a scrape on the front bumper as pictured.
There is a small rattle/vibrate from a piece of trim in the back somewhere that I haven't located yet when you accelerate away. This stops when the interior warms up (just being as honest as I can be)
Needs the badges replacing as they have faded (have ordered some stickers which will be included when car sells if they arrive in time)
